Output d5e2567d6c66bfa078fb93b292793554906c89128a5ef0862e9b4299e0d0d4c6:6

value
77601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823600704f6cc4b336fcaf0e11f853041900189d OP_EQUAL
address
3DZWTayRqYTMBXDoK57ioCHdYx7KpaSaXP
transaction
d5e2567d6c66bfa078fb93b292793554906c89128a5ef0862e9b4299e0d0d4c6